The impact of global oil price fluctuations
Oil prices are influenced by a variety of factors, including the global economic outlook, changes in supply and demand, and geopolitical tensions. The impact of fluctuations in global oil prices can be felt across economies and societies, and understanding these impacts is crucial in navigating the complex landscape of energy markets and their interplay with economic and geopolitical forces.
During the COVID-19 pandemic, the world witnessed a significant drop in demand for oil due to lockdowns and travel restrictions, resulting in a historic decline in oil prices. This was further exacerbated by the oil price war between Russia and Saudi Arabia, which contributed to the steepest drop in oil prices ever recorded. The pandemic's impact on the global economy, along with factors like economic policy uncertainty and market volatility, played a significant role in driving down oil prices.
However, the story doesn't end there. Oil price fluctuations have far-reaching consequences that go beyond the immediate market dynamics. Firstly, they directly affect the price of gasoline at the pump, impacting consumers' wallets and influencing inflation rates. This impact is felt not just in the cost of transportation but also in the prices of goods and services across the board, as oil is a crucial feedstock and energy source in various industries. The impact on inflation can be significant, especially when coupled with economic uncertainties and shifts in global equity markets.
The ripple effects of oil price changes also create a dynamic between oil-producing and oil-consuming countries. High oil prices benefit exporting countries while challenging importing countries, leading to shifts in economic power and trade dynamics. Additionally, fluctuations in oil prices can influence the market for renewable energy and alternative solutions. For instance, rising oil prices can make electric vehicles and other climate-friendly alternatives more economically attractive, potentially accelerating the transition away from fossil fuels.
Moreover, oil price fluctuations can have notable geopolitical implications. For instance, the recent tensions between Russia and Ukraine, coupled with Middle Eastern tensions, have contributed to supply fears, impacting oil prices and global economic recovery efforts. These complex interactions highlight the intricate relationship between energy markets, geopolitics, and economic stability.
In conclusion, the impact of global oil price fluctuations is far-reaching and complex. It influences consumer prices, inflation rates, trade dynamics between nations, the adoption of renewable energy alternatives, and even geopolitical strategies. Understanding these impacts is essential for policymakers, economists, and energy market stakeholders as they navigate the challenges and opportunities presented by the ever-changing landscape of global energy markets and their profound influence on the world economy and society at large.

Natural phenomena and their influence
Fuel prices are influenced by a multitude of factors, some of which are natural phenomena. Natural phenomena can impact fuel prices in various ways, including through their effects on supply, demand, and refining costs.
One significant natural phenomenon that can influence fuel prices is weather events. For example, extreme weather conditions such as hurricanes, floods, or fires can disrupt oil production, refining, and distribution infrastructure, leading to reduced supply and increased prices. Additionally, weather events can influence the demand for fuel. For instance, colder winters can lead to increased demand for heating oil, while milder winters may result in lower consumption.
Seasonal variations are another natural phenomenon that plays a role in fuel pricing. Gasoline demand typically increases during the summer months as more people travel for vacations and recreation. This higher demand can lead to increased prices. Similarly, seasonal variations in weather can impact the production and distribution of biofuel sources, such as ethanol, which is often blended with gasoline. Disruptions in the supply of these biofuels can affect the overall gasoline supply and pricing.
Geopolitical tensions and regional conflicts can also be considered natural phenomena to the extent that they are part of the social and political landscape. These issues can influence fuel prices by impacting oil supply chains and markets. For example, the Russia-Ukraine conflict led to a decision by the Biden administration to ban imports of Russian oil, affecting global oil supplies and prices. Similarly, regional tensions in oil-producing countries can disrupt production and supply chains, causing fluctuations in fuel prices.
Natural disasters are another phenomenon that can directly impact fuel prices by disrupting oil extraction, refining, and transportation infrastructure. For example, earthquakes, tsunamis, or hurricanes can damage oil refineries and distribution networks, reducing supply and increasing costs. Additionally, natural disasters can displace workers in the oil industry, affecting production capacity and supply levels.
It is important to recognize that the influence of natural phenomena on fuel prices is often interconnected with other economic, political, and social factors. The overall impact on fuel pricing can be complex and subject to various feedback mechanisms and market dynamics.

Government intervention and taxation
Fuel prices are influenced by a variety of factors, including government intervention and taxation policies, which vary across different countries and regions. Government intervention in fuel pricing can take several forms, including taxes, subsidies, price caps, and environmental regulations.
One common form of government intervention is fuel taxation. Taxes on gasoline and diesel can be implemented at the federal, state, or local level, and they vary by country and region. For example, as of July 1, 2024, the federal excise tax rate on gasoline in the United States was 18.3 cents per gallon, while diesel fuel was taxed at 24.3 cents per gallon. State taxes may include excise taxes, environmental taxes, special taxes, and inspection fees, further adding to the overall tax burden. In other countries, fuel taxes can be significantly higher. For instance, in Germany, as of December 2019, fuel taxes and Value-Added Tax (VAT) resulted in prices of €1.12 per litre for ultra-low-sulphur diesel and €1.27 per litre for unleaded petrol. Similarly, in the Netherlands, fuel excise taxes as of 2015 were EUR0.766 per litre for petrol and EUR0.482 per litre for diesel.
In some countries, fuel taxes serve as a form of implicit carbon pricing, addressing the social and environmental costs associated with gasoline consumption. Organizations such as the Intergovernmental Panel on Climate Change, the International Energy Agency, the International Monetary Fund, and the World Bank have advocated for higher gasoline tax rates to promote a transition to carbon-neutral economies. However, fuel tax reforms can be contentious, as illustrated by the opposition faced by the State Council in China when attempting to institute a fuel tax to finance the National Trunk Highway System.
In contrast to taxation, some governments provide subsidies for fossil fuels, which can influence fuel prices. However, these subsidies have been criticized for perpetuating the use of unreliable and environmentally harmful energy sources. There have been calls to phase out such subsidies gradually, redirecting the savings towards mitigating the impact of higher fuel prices on low-income households and promoting a transition to more efficient and environmentally friendly energy sources.
Another form of government intervention is the implementation of price caps. In some countries with liberalized markets, governments may partially control the end-user price of gasoline to limit fluctuations caused by variations in crude oil prices. This approach can help stabilize fuel prices and protect consumers from abrupt increases.
The impact of government intervention on fuel prices is complex and varies depending on regional factors, energy affordability, and industrial competitiveness. In countries with high GDP per capita and low population density, such as Australia, Canada, and the United States (Cluster C), taxation tends to be lower, resulting in more affordable fuel prices. In contrast, European countries often have higher taxation rates, with taxes accounting for a significant portion of the final fuel price. For example, in the Netherlands, taxes can account for up to 68.84% of the total price of petrol.

Regional price variations
The retail fuel price is closely related to the global oil price fluctuation. The global oil price is in a constant state of flux, with political elements, such as regime changes, policies, and international relations, all playing a role in the cost of fuel. For example, a shift in government policy towards recognizing climate change may result in changes to the cost of fuel for consumers. Natural disasters, such as earthquakes, hurricanes, and floods, can also affect the production and logistics of gasoline, influencing fuel prices.
Within a country, fuel prices can vary significantly across regions and states. In the United States, for instance, Hawaii and California are known for having higher fuel prices, whereas Mississippi and Louisiana offer more affordable options. These differences can be attributed to factors such as local taxes, refinery access, and supply disruptions.
To make informed decisions about refueling, drivers can utilize various gas apps, such as GasBuddy, Waze, and Google Maps, which provide real-time fuel price information. These apps also offer rewards programs that can help users save money at the pump. Additionally, strategic use of credit card rewards and loyalty programs can further maximize savings on fuel purchases.
It is worth noting that prices can fluctuate daily and even differ depending on the day of the week, with Mondays typically offering cheaper fuel prices compared to Fridays and Saturdays. By staying informed and adapting their refueling strategies, drivers can optimize their fuel costs, especially when embarking on road trips or traveling across different regions.

Strategies to reduce fuel costs
Fuel prices are a significant concern for businesses operating vehicle fleets, as well as individual drivers. As fuel costs rise, it is important to find ways to reduce fuel consumption and cut down on expenses. Here are some strategies to help keep fuel costs down:
Maintain Your Vehicle
Regular car servicing is essential to maintaining your vehicle's fuel efficiency. Engine parts work closely together, and if they are poorly maintained, sludge and corrosion will build up, causing the engine to work less efficiently. Using a good high-performance engine oil can help reduce friction in the engine, combat sludge, and improve fuel economy. Ensuring your tires are correctly inflated is also important, as underinflated tires can increase fuel consumption by up to 10%.
Drive Efficiently
Aggressive driving behaviours such as slamming on the brakes and hard accelerations increase fuel consumption. Driving at a constant speed, using cruise control (in automatic vehicles), and maintaining a higher gear when appropriate can reduce fuel consumption by reducing the number of engine revolutions per minute (RPM). When approaching a hill, start accelerating before you reach it, rather than at the foot of the hill. Additionally, every extra 50kg of weight in your vehicle increases fuel consumption by 2%, so it's worth considering whether you need all the items you're carrying.
Utilise Technology
GPS fleet management systems can provide valuable data to help improve your fleet's performance and reduce fuel costs. These systems enable you to track vehicle performance and maintain driver safety.
Encourage Safe Driving
Teaching and encouraging safe driving practices can help minimise fuel spending. This includes avoiding tailgating, driving at excessive speeds, and driving with the windows down at high speeds, as these behaviours increase wind resistance and fuel consumption.
By implementing these strategies and staying informed about fuel costs and efficient driving practices, you can help keep fuel costs under control.
